Output 29bb0ef41d4146f5d5a2cefff85c679dbccd4e1982901346926a4f382c03007d:0

value
655063
script pubkey
OP_0 OP_PUSHBYTES_20 21a76cc98660c95f232f8f310c1433f52b57da85
address
bc1qyxnkejvxvry47ge03ucsc9pn75440k590w8fez
transaction
29bb0ef41d4146f5d5a2cefff85c679dbccd4e1982901346926a4f382c03007d
confirmations
147827
spent
true